About Tungsten Carbide Inserts

Today, carbide inserts are produced in different classifications to offer reliable, consistent performance for various materials or applications. Carbide inserts are particularly appropriate when wear is an issue. The exceptional hardness and stability of tungsten carbide allows machining to meet very exacting tolerances while at the same time minimizing equipment wear. Plus, carbide inserts are more resistant to abrasion at high or low temperatures, ensuring cost-effective performance over the lifetime of the insert.

Customers case: the solution when a insert is failed on performance:

Vibration
High radial cutting forces due to vibrations or chatter marks which are caused by the tooling or the tool mounting. Typical for internal machining with boring bars.
Cause:
  • Unsuitable entering angle
  • Nose radius is too large
  • Unsuitable edge rounding, or negative chamfer
  • Excessive flank wear on the cutting edge​

Solution:

  • Select a larger entering angle (lead angle).
  • Select a smaller nose radius
  • Select a grade with a thin coating, or an uncoated grade​
  • Select a more wear resistant grade or reduce speed
